Gradient-based adaptive IIR notch filtering for frequency estimation

Abstract
The use of gradient-based algorithms with infinite impulse response (IIR) notch filtering for estimating sinusoids imbedded in noise is investigated. Two notch filter model structures are presented. The first is for applications where two signal sources with correlated noise components can be accessed. The second can be used in situations where only one composite signal source is available. Error surface analysis indicates that second-order modules are unimodal and result in guaranteed convergence. Higher-order modules are multimodal and require judicious choice of initial parameter estimates.
